Shifting Trade Dynamics: Cuba’s Emerging Role in Latin America
The landscape of global trade is undergoing critically important changes, particularly in the context of the United States’ interactions with its Latin American neighbors. In an unexpected twist, Cuba has begun to assert itself as a notable player on the geopolitical front. As President Trump’s stringent trade measures aim to redefine economic ties across the region, Cuba is positioning itself as a potential ally for nations seeking alternatives to U.S.dominance. This article delves into how these trade tensions are not only transforming economic relationships but also revitalizing Cuba’s influence within regional politics and commerce. Understanding this evolution is essential for comprehending future U.S.-Latin American relations in an increasingly intricate global habitat.
Impact of Trade Tensions on Latin American Economies
The effects of Trump’s trade strategies on economies throughout Latin America are still unfolding, with Cuba emerging as a key player amid these transitions. As tariffs rise and existing agreements between the U.S.and other countries become more strained, Cuba’s strategic location and historical connections with various Latin American nations provide it with unique advantages. Several factors contribute to this transformative scenario:
- Strategic Location: Positioned centrally, Cuba can act as a vital conduit for goods traveling between the United States and other parts of Latin America.
- Diversified Markets: With U.S.-imposed sanctions disrupting established trading routes, Cuba may bolster its ties with countries such as Venezuela and Mexico to secure necessary imports.
- Political Connections: Long-standing relationships with leftist governments could enable Cuba to forge new alliances aimed at counterbalancing U.S. influence.
As regional economies contend with the ramifications of U.S. protectionism, there exists potential for enhanced partnerships that could elevate Cuba’s role in facilitating trade across borders. The following table presents key economic indicators that may shape this trajectory:

Cuba: A Key Player in Evolving Trade Alliances
Cuba finds itself at a pivotal juncture where it can utilize its geographic advantages alongside diplomatic relations to navigate complex shifts in international alliances amidst Trump’s aggressive trade policies. As barriers rise between the United States and numerous Latin American nations, longstanding connections with influential partners like China and Russia present opportunities for re-establishing itself as a crucial regional hub—offering strategic benefits to neighboring countries looking beyond traditional American markets.
The changing dynamics within regional commerce may prompt various nations to reassess their partnerships due to rising tariffs and sanctions reshaping their environments. Notable implications include:
- Sparking Investment Opportunities:Cuba could attract foreign direct investment from countries eager to circumvent reliance on U.S markets.
- Pursuing New Trade Agreements:A partnership framework involving China might unlock access to resources along with technological advancements.
- Pursuing Regional Stability:Tighter bonds formed through collaboration with Venezuela or similar governments could enhance political leverage for Havana.
